J17 Instruction Manual 3-1 RS Ć232D Interface Y ou can use the J17 Photometer's RS Ć232D port to read measurements to a remote terminal, or to save measurement readings to a file on a computer . Any ASCII terminal or communications software may comĆ municate with the J17 via the RSĆ232D port.

Appendix C: Chromaticity Reference J17 Instruction Manual C-5 FigureĂCĆ3 shows selected isotemperature lines in the x,y coordinate system. A light source along one of the isotemperature lines will most nearly match the color temperature of a blackbody radiator indicated for that line.
